🔵VK

Модуль работает в штатном, для всех версий, и расширенном режиме для Pro. Выгружает товары из магазина в VK, загружает заказы в магазин, обновляет прайс и остатки.

Какие товары выгружаются в ВКонтакте:

  • Товары из категории, которая указана в настройках модуля VK.

  • Товары, которые отметили в карточке товара для выгрузки в VK во вкладе Модули.

  • Товары, у которых загружено фото более 400*400 пикселей.

  • Цена товара больше нуля.

Что выгружается в ВКонтакте

  • Название товара

  • Краткое, подробное описание товара

  • Цена

  • Категория

  • Вес

  • Габариты

Работа в штатном режиме для всех версий

Настройка модуля

  1. Установите модуль в меню Модули - Управление модулями - Маркетплейсы VK Товары.

  2. В настройках модуля выберите модель работы Обновление данных через YML.

  3. В поле Размещение , если нужно выгружать конкретные каталоги. Конкретный товар можно также отметить из его карточки в закладке Модули.

  4. Сохраните настройки.

Настройки в кабинете VK

  1. Создайте сообщество https://vk.com/groups?w=groups_create

  2. Выберите тип сообщества - Развивать бизнес.

  3. Заполните необходимые данные.

  1. Зайдите в меню Настройки магазина - Товары и выберите расширенный режим.

  1. Перейдите в раздел Товары. Нажмите Добавить товар - импортировать из файла. Укажите в поле YML ссылку http://имя-сайта.ru/yml/?marketplace=vk. Нажмите Добавить товары.

Если у товара не заполнено описание, фото, он не попадет в выгрузку, даже если отмечен к выгрузке.

Если необходимо изменить данные, нужно указать ссылку заново.

Выгрузка готова 🎉

Работа модуля в расширенном режиме для Pro

Pro версия позволяет не только выгружать товары с сайта, но и загружать товары с ВК. Также можно получать заказы с VK, online обновлять цены и остатки, при изменении товара на сайте, либо с заданной периодичностью через модуль Задачи (по cron).

Настройки в кабинете VK

  1. Создайте приложение с любым именем по ссылке https://vk.com/editapp?act=create. В поле Платформа выберите Сайт. Нажмите Перейти в сервис.

  2. Авторизуйтесь или создайте аккаунт (выберите свой тип аккаунта, заполните данные, нажмите Создать аккаунт).

  1. В окне Регистрация приложения введите Название, тип платформы WEB, нажмите Далее.

  1. На шаге 2 укажите:

  • Базовый домен без https

  • В поле Доверенный redirect URI укажите ссылку http://site.ru/phpshop/modules/vkseller/token.php.

Готовые ссылки можно взять в разделе . Нажмите Готово.

  1. Перейдите в раздел Доступы приложения и заполните необходимые данные:

Настройка Модуля

  1. Установите модуль в меню Модули - Управление модулями - Маркетплейсы VK Товары.

  2. Для работы в расширенном режиме, убедитесь, что у вас версия магазина Pro, и в настройках модуля выберите модель работы Обновление данных через API и YML. Нажмите Сохранить.

  1. Перейдите в созданное приложение в VK - раздел Настройки. Скопируйте поля ID приложения и Защищённый ключ в одноименные поля в настройках модуля магазина.

  1. Откройте страницу сообщества, которое привязали к приложению. Введите цифры из его url после public в поле ID сообщества в модуле магазина:

  1. Укажите статус заказов, которые будут загружаться с ВКонтакте.

  2. Укажите Статус заказа в VK для автоматической загрузки.

  3. Нажмите Сохранить.

  4. Для получения API key все поля должны быть заполнены и сохранены в настройках модуля.

Перейдите по ссылке Получить Персональный ключ, полученные ключ сохраните в поле API key. Нажмите Сохранить.

Модуль готов к работе 🎉

Выгрузка товаров в ВКонтакте

  1. Отметьте нужные каталоги для выгрузки в VK в модуле и нажмите Сохранить. Можно отметить конкретный товар, в его карточке в закладке Модули.

  1. В карточке каталога, перейдите в закладку ВКонтакте и сопоставьте свою категорию с категорией ВКонтакте. Нажмите Сохранить. Если категорию не сопоставить, товары попадут в общий каталог.

  1. Для выгрузки в ВКонтакте нажмите кнопку Экспортировать данные:

Видеть в каталоге, какие товары выгружаются в VK можно, добавив значок vk в меню ⚙️ - Настройка полей - Лейбл VK:

  1. Зайдите в магазин VK и проверьте результат 🎉:

Остатки и цены

Остатки и цены выгружаются автоматически при редактировании карточки товара в магазине.

Для выгрузки цен и остатков в ВКонтакте по расписанию, можно добавить новую задачу в модуль Задачи с адресом запускаемого файла:

phpshop/modules/vkseller/cron/products.php.

Загрузка заказов с ВКонтакте

Заказ появляется в магазине автоматически, сразу после создания в VK. Список заказов для загрузки из ВКонтакте доступен в разделе Модули - VK Товары - Заказы из VK.

Учет товаров в заказе происходит по полям VK ID (товар выгружен по API) или ID, Артикул (товар выгружен через YML-файл).

По клику на номер заказа откроется карточка, с описанием данных по заказу с ВКонтакте. В закладке Дополнительно предпросмотра заказа с ВКонтакте выводится полная информация по заказу в виде массива данных.

Для загрузки заказа используется кнопка Загрузить заказ. Загруженный заказ будет иметь статус, выбранный в настройках модуля. В поле Примечания администратора загруженного заказа будет информация о загрузке с ВКонтакте и его номер.

Для автоматической загрузки заказа, в настройках модуля укажите Статус заказа в VK для автоматической загрузки.

Для повторной загрузки заказа, удалите его из базы заказов в магазине.

Импорт товаров с ВКонтакте

Список товаров для загрузки из ВКонтакте доступен в разделе Модули - VK Товары - Товары из VK.

По клику на название товара откроется карточка, с описанием данных по товару с ВКонтакте. Для загрузки товара используется кнопка Загрузить товар. Для повторной загрузки товара удалите его из базы товаров в магазине.

Кнопка Купить в ВКонтакте

Для удобства покупателей, можно вывести кнопку с переходом на соцсеть, для покупки товара в ВКонтакте. Для этого отметьте опцию Показать ссылку на товар в ВК.

Для отображения в карточке товара ссылки на товар в ВКонтакте в шаблоне используется переменная @vkseller_link@

Last updated